GORE™ High Flex Flat Cable (Discrete Length)
 GORE™ High Flex Flat Cables are used in applications where flex life reliability is critical. The reliable performance of GORE™ High Flex Flat Cables reduces expensive equipment downtime and field repair due to cable failure. Gore’s extensive material knowledge and design experience provide proven solutions for demanding applications. GORE™ High Flex Discrete Length Flat Cables provide reliability, superior performance and quick lead times with no minimum order quantities.
GORE™ High Flex Discrete Length Flat Cable enables customers to design and purchase a piece of cable instead of a spool or large quantity. This option is cost effective when small quantities are needed or demand is uncertain. The cable comes with the ends prepped for easy termination and can be used in any energy chain or cable track.
Key Features
-
Proven flex life greater than 20 million cycles at 50 mm
(2") bend radius
-
Clean, non-particulating jacket
-
Easy on-line design tool
-
No minimum order quantities

On-Line Design Tool
Gore’s on-line design tool provides system designers with step-by-step instructions to configure GORE™ High Flex Flat Cable (spooled or discrete length), GORE™ High Flex Round Cable, or GORE™ Trackless Cable from standard components. The design process is quick and easy. Just select your cable cores from the menu of offerings, choose a confi guration, place cores within your cable configuration, and submit the specification to Gore.
Product Specifications
| Max Overall Length of Each Cable |
5.0 m (16.4 ft.) |
| Maximum Self-Supporting Stroke Length1 |
500 mm (20 in.) |
| Maximum Acceleration |
4 G (39 m/s2) |
| Temperature |
–40°C to 80°C |
| Cable Core Types |
Signal, Power, Fiber Optic, and Pneumatic |
| Cable Certifications |
UL2, CSA, and CE |
1 Base plate required. 2 UL Style 21090:80°C, pneumatic tubes are not UL recognized
